El Al Israel Orders 12 New Boeing 787 Aircraft

El Al Israel Airlines has ordered 12 new Boeing 787 aircraft to expand its long-haul operations, under a deal worth approximately $1.5 billion. The announcement was made on April 16, 2026.

As part of the plan, the airline will exercise its option for six 787-9 aircraft and convert four previously ordered planes into the larger 787-10 variant. Deliveries are scheduled between 2030 and 2032.

In addition, El Al holds options for six more aircraft to be delivered between 2033 and 2035. The airline aims to increase its 787 fleet to 28 aircraft, with the potential to reach 34 if all options are exercised.
